The festive season is just around the corner, and emotions are at their peak. From festive decor to delicious delights, everything is planned, but we often forget to plan what to eat and how to track our eating schedule. As emotions run high, people tend to overeat, sometimes out of celebration, sometimes out of stress or nostalgia. But what this does to the body is a bigger concern.
“Whenever you overeat, or you are taking excess calories, the type of food you eat matters,” says Dr . Suranjit Chatterjee, Internal Medicine, Apollo Hospital. He adds, “If you are eating the right food, not a lot of fat or calories, it may help your satiety. But overeating fatty foods or sugars over time can have a detrimental effect.”
